本文目录导读:
在当今信息化时代,服务器作为企业、个人及各类组织的基础设施,其稳定性和可靠性至关重要,在实际使用过程中,我们经常会遇到服务器返回无效数据的情况,这不仅影响了用户体验,也给业务运行带来了诸多不便,服务器返回无效数据的原因有哪些?我们又该如何应对这一现象呢?
服务器返回无效数据的原因
1、数据格式错误
图片来源于网络,如有侵权联系删除
数据格式错误是导致服务器返回无效数据最常见的原因之一,在数据传输过程中,若发送方和接收方对数据格式的定义不一致,就会导致数据无法正确解析,进而产生无效数据。
2、数据传输错误
数据在传输过程中可能会受到干扰,如网络拥堵、信号衰减等,导致数据丢失或损坏,最终形成无效数据。
3、服务器配置错误
服务器配置错误也是导致无效数据出现的一个重要原因,数据库连接配置错误、内存不足、磁盘空间不足等,都会影响数据的有效性。
4、服务器硬件故障
服务器硬件故障,如CPU、内存、硬盘等部件损坏,也会导致服务器无法正确处理数据,从而产生无效数据。
5、系统漏洞
系统漏洞是黑客攻击的重要途径,一旦服务器受到攻击,系统漏洞就会被利用,导致数据被篡改或损坏,形成无效数据。
6、软件错误
图片来源于网络,如有侵权联系删除
软件错误主要包括程序逻辑错误、算法错误等,这些错误会导致服务器在处理数据时出现偏差,进而产生无效数据。
应对服务器返回无效数据的策略
1、数据校验
在数据传输过程中,对数据进行校验可以有效地避免无效数据的产生,常用的校验方法有MD5、SHA-1等。
2、数据备份与恢复
定期对数据进行备份,一旦发现无效数据,可以迅速恢复到正常状态,减少损失。
3、优化服务器配置
针对服务器配置错误,及时调整数据库连接、内存、磁盘空间等参数,确保服务器正常运行。
4、提高硬件质量
选择优质的服务器硬件,降低硬件故障带来的风险。
5、定期更新系统与软件
图片来源于网络,如有侵权联系删除
及时修复系统漏洞和软件错误,提高服务器安全性。
6、数据清洗
对于已产生的无效数据,可以通过数据清洗工具进行处理,将无效数据剔除。
7、加强网络安全防护
提高网络安全防护能力,防止黑客攻击,确保数据安全。
8、优化网络环境
优化网络环境,降低网络拥堵和信号衰减对数据传输的影响。
服务器返回无效数据是一个复杂的问题,需要从多个方面进行解决,通过分析原因,采取相应的应对策略,可以有效降低无效数据对业务运行的影响,提高用户体验。
标签: #服务器返回无效数据
评论列表